How is a cold hammer forged barrel made?

How is a cold hammer forged barrel made?

The forging process involves threading a short and thick steel rod onto a mandrel and then beating the mass of steel into the final shape of a barrel. How does cold hammer forging work?

Cold hammer forging produces accurate and durable barrels. During cold hammer forging, Tikka barrels are hammered from all sides against the mandrel inside the barrel, transferring the mirror image of the rifling machined on the surface of the mandrel. How was early rifling done?

An early method of introducing rifling to a pre-drilled barrel was to use a cutter mounted on a square-section rod, accurately twisted into a spiral of the desired pitch, mounted in two fixed square-section holes. As the cutter was advanced through the barrel it twisted at a uniform rate governed by the pitch.

Are cold hammer forged barrels good?

The cold hammer-forging process produces barrels of excellent quality. They are not common on match-grade or varmint barrels, as their accuracy is perceived to be inferior to cut- or button-rifling methods. Advantages of Hammer Forging: Hammer forging consistently produces high-quality barrels.

Why is a spinning bullets more accurate?

Rifling refers to the spiral grooves that are cut into the internal surface of a gun barrel. Rifling helps impart a spinning motion to a bullet when it’s fired. A spinning bullet is much more stable in its trajectory, and is therefore more accurate than a bullet that doesn’t spin.

What is ammunition primer?

In firearms and artillery, the primer (/ˈpraɪmər/) is the chemical and/or device responsible for initiating the propellant combustion that will push the projectiles out of the gun barrel. In smaller weapons the primer is usually of the first type and integrated into the base of a cartridge.

Is button rifling good?

Button-rifled barrels are very accurate. Bore and groove dimensions are very consistent. Disadvantages of button rifling: Button rifling creates stress in a barrel; high-quality button-rifled barrels must be stress-relieved after rifling.

How does a gun barrel get its rigidity?

The repeated blows by the hammers align the molecular “grain” within the metal, increasing rigidity and strength. The last, but important, part is that a mandrel and reamer are used to form the chamber, bore and rifling as the hammers pummel and elongate the barrel.

What is broach rifling for pistol barrels?

Broach rifling for pistol barrels uses upstream manufacturing, allowing manufacturers to machine outside features, and then broach rifle, eliminating multiple setups. Popularity – Because of the upstream manufacturing efficiencies, broach rifling is a popular process for pistol barrels.

Do hammer forged barrels really work?

All About Barrels: The fact that hammer forging works is attested to by the fact that most of the major firearms manufacturers use it-Remington, Winchester, Ruger, Sako and Steyr, to name a few. Indeed, Savage may be the only major company that uses button rifling. Obviously, either method is capable of prod-ucing an accurate barrel.
